-
Notifications
You must be signed in to change notification settings - Fork 9
Meet Builders
Vanessa Sochat edited this page Oct 14, 2017
·
8 revisions
Hi there, I'm one of the Singularity Hub robots! I'm here to help build your containers.

A builder is an instance, deployed on demand when it's needed, on Google Cloud.
- Machine Type: The machine type is a n1-standard-1. This is a rather little guy, with 1 virtual CPU and 3.75 GB of memory. It works for building.
- Size For the first version of Singularity Hub, given that builds needed to have size estimated, we also offered a larger 100GB instance. Now that we are using a more optimized compression format for image files, we are starting out trying just offering 50GB instances.
- Singularity Version The new Singularity Hub supports building version 2.4 and up images, which are secure and read only. Legacy images ported from the old version (ext3) will be frozen, and the only different format.
- Operating System The base OS is Ubuntu 16.04 with LTS.
The instance, for Singularity 2.0, comes with software and libraries essential for Singularity and the Singularity python software. We also install several modules (e.g., yum, deboostrap) for the build environment to address all the bugs that come with building certain images :)
Note that the build is done in an enclosed environment on the host, so you will not have any access to the host.
If you have different needs than our default builders, please reach out.
Need help? submit an issue and let us know!